Abstract

Genetic divergence was studied among 30 indigenous genotypes of snap melon (Cucumis melo L. var. momordica) for 19 important quantitative and qualitative characters using D2 statistics. The genotypes were grouped into five clusters based on D2 values, which exhibited no association between geographical distance and genetic divergence. Maximum divergence was observed between clusters I and III followed by I and V. The clusters showing high genetic divergence could be effectively utilized in heterosis breeding programme.
